At the moment the welcome private message is sent as soon as an account is created. I need users to verify their email address, so it would be great if the welcoming private message could be sent after a user had verified their email address because as it is they receive a notification of a private message that they can't access.
If that's not possible, would it be possible to make it at least be sent after the verification email, as at the moment users who register are told to look in their inbox for an email with a link. Private message notification is on by default so when the welcome private message is sent it triggers an automatic private message notification and that is actually arriving in the inbox before the verification email. Obviously, if users haven't verified their email address they can't access the private message they are being told about.
